碳纳米管在癌症诊断与治疗中的应用

Carbon nanotubes in cancer diagnosis and therapy.

作者信息

Ji Shun-rong, Liu Chen, Zhang Bo, Yang Feng, Xu Jin, Long Jiang, Jin Chen, Fu De-liang, Ni Quan-xing, Yu Xian-jun

机构信息

Department of General Surgery, Huashan Hospital, Fudan University, Shanghai, 200040, China.

出版信息

Biochim Biophys Acta. 2010 Aug;1806(1):29-35. doi: 10.1016/j.bbcan.2010.02.004. Epub 2010 Feb 26.

DOI:10.1016/j.bbcan.2010.02.004
PMID:20193746
Abstract

During the past years, great progress has been made in the field of nanomaterials given their great potential in biomedical applications. Carbon nanotubes (CNTs), due to their unique physicochemical properties, have become a popular tool in cancer diagnosis and therapy. They are considered one of the most promising nanomaterials with the capability of both detecting the cancerous cells and delivering drugs or small therapeutic molecules to these cells. Over the last several years, CNTs have been explored in almost every single cancer treatment modality, including drug delivery, lymphatic targeted chemotherapy, thermal therapy, photodynamic therapy, and gene therapy. In this review, we will show how they have been introduced into the diagnosis and treatment of cancer. Novel SWNT-based tumor-targeted drug delivery systems (DDS) will be highlighted. Furthermore, the in vitro and in vivo toxicity of CNTs reported in recent years will be summarized.

摘要

在过去几年中,鉴于纳米材料在生物医学应用中的巨大潜力,该领域取得了巨大进展。碳纳米管(CNTs)由于其独特的物理化学性质,已成为癌症诊断和治疗中的一种常用工具。它们被认为是最有前途的纳米材料之一,具有检测癌细胞以及向这些细胞递送药物或小分子治疗剂的能力。在过去几年中,几乎在每一种癌症治疗方式中都对碳纳米管进行了探索,包括药物递送、淋巴靶向化疗、热疗、光动力疗法和基因疗法。在本综述中,我们将展示它们是如何被引入癌症诊断和治疗的。将重点介绍基于新型单壁碳纳米管的肿瘤靶向药物递送系统(DDS)。此外,还将总结近年来报道的碳纳米管的体外和体内毒性。
